Company Overview

ABN AMRO Bank is a leading full-service bank headquartered in Amsterdam, Netherlands, with roots tracing back to the 19th century. Formed in 1991 through the merger of Algemene Bank Nederland and Amsterdam-Rotterdam Bank, ABN AMRO went through a period of nationalization in 2008 before returning to the private market via an initial public offering in 2015. The bank operates under the supervision of De Nederlandsche Bank and the European Central Bank, reflecting its role in both domestic and cross-border financial services regulation.

The bank’s core activities span retail banking, private banking, corporate and institutional banking, and wealth management. ABN AMRO offers a comprehensive suite of products and services, including savings and deposit accounts, mortgages, consumer and corporate loans, payment processing, trade and commodity finance, investment products, custody services, and asset management solutions. Through digital platforms and mobile banking apps, the institution has invested heavily in technology to enhance customer experience and streamline operations.

While the Netherlands constitutes ABN AMRO’s primary market, the bank maintains an international presence with offices and branches across Europe, the Americas, Asia, and the Middle East. This network supports multinational corporations, institutional investors, and high-net-worth individuals seeking access to global markets and specialized financial products, including sustainable and impact financing.

Governance is overseen by an executive board and a supervisory board, with Robert Swaak serving as Chief Executive Officer since January 2020. Under his leadership, ABN AMRO has placed strategic emphasis on digital transformation, environmental, social and governance (ESG) integration, and the acceleration of sustainable finance initiatives aimed at supporting clients’ transition to low-carbon economies.
